quote:
Originally posted by ianofbhills
engine mounts £40
corsa gsi driveshaffts (pleanty strong enough for 2.0 power and no messing with hubs) £40
mk2 cav inner cv's £60
lmf 2.0 shortshift gear linkage £70
2.0 16v brakes if you havnt got them £70
xe inlet adaptor plate and x20xe inlet hose £35
complete engine (from ebay there are loads for sale regularly for this price) £200
rebuild bits for engine cambelt oil etc £100
cut and shut standard exhaust manifold onto standard exhaust free
fit engine yourself free

£650



Mines not much different from that V6 brakes etc and mines over £1500 so far...
